ARTISANS ALONG THE AVENUE
The Norfolk Arts Center is pleased to announce that we are reinvisioning our biggest fundraising event of the year while still incorporating the well awaited soup from local restaurants, a wide variety of regional artists, and our exclusive silent auction products.

We are excited to announce our first “Artisans Along the Avenue” happening January 29, 2022.

“Artisans Along the Avenue” is bringing our beloved event to a crawl along Norfolk Avenue’s Downtown drag. The Norfolk Arts Center would like to invite you to be a part of its soup and art crawl taking place in the heart of Norfolk. Soups will be made and served in house at a variety of restaurants’ locations. Stationed at each restaurant will be one of our many talented regional artists and their booths.

“Artisans Along the Avenue” attendees are invited to sample soups created by Northeast Nebraska’s finest restaurants and chefs while seeing local artists demonstrate their talent as you shop the booths and enjoy the variety of venues and the overall ambiance of the downtown stretch.

Enjoy these participating restaurants, Black Cow Fat Pig, The 411, The Pier, District Table and Tap, Taylormade Catering, and White Mulberry Bakery along with fantastic regional artist who will be sharing their craft in the restaurants. At the Norfolk Arts Center enjoy hot chocolate and a demonstration from the Wayne State Art Club. The silent auction items will be on display at the Art Center and bidding will be open virtually from Saturday, January 29th through January 30th at midnight. HYBRID RECEPTION
Two new exhibitions were hung in the gallery and atrium this past month and the artists were invited to attend a reception to welcome them into the Norfolk Arts Center. This also allowed patrons to interact and find out the background of the artists as well as the story behind the exhibitions. 

We welcomed Anastacia Drake and Sally Jurgensmier to the Arts Center. Sally joined us in person and Anastacia joined us through a Zoom call projected on the wall in the Gallery. This was a new experience and gave us insight into working with the technology and will allow us to offer this in the future as well. 

Anastacia detailed how her work with layered acrylic took a leap when she worked with a young lady who was losing her eyesight and found a way to share with others how she interacts with the world by touch. Sally shared how she came to work with metal while she was in college and a professor telling her she needed to finally choose a discipline. This led her to take up sculpture and eventually led to metal work. 
 
Exhibitions on display through February 24, 2022
